AHCCCS
recently awarded contracts that will result in changes to PHS
Acute Care members in Pima and Santa Cruz Counties. If you are
on the Long Term Care plan (ALTCS) you will continue on PHS, you
do not need to make any changes.
PHS
will continue to serve all of its membership until the current
contract expires on September 30, 2008. A total of about 27,000
current PHS members will be changed to a new plan effective
October 1, 2008. The remaining PHS dual eligible members (Medicare
& Medicaid (about 3,000)) will continue with PHS after October
1, 2008, these members do not need to make any changes.
PHS
will be working closely with AHCCCS and the health plans to make
sure PHS members are transitioned to a new health plan without
disruption to their health care services.
The
affected PHS members will be assigned to an available health plan
in their county by AHCCCS and notified of their new health plan
assignment in July 2008. These members can stay with the health
plan AHCCCS selects for them or choose a different health plan by
August 31, 2008.
Members
will also have a chance to change health plans (if desired) during
another enrollment choice period of October 1 through November 30,
2008. The effective date of the member move to the new health plan
will be October 1, 2008.
Affected
members will receive more information directly from AHCCCS.
